Residents of Raunds will soon be familiar with robots roaming their streets following DPD's launch of autonomous robot deliveries in the town. DPD, the UK's leading courier company, has decided to begin using robots to deliver customer parcels in the area after a successful trial of the scheme in Milton Keynes.

Raunds is one of the 10 towns within the UK to be selected for this scheme. Raunds is home to Warth Park, where DPD have a depot and where the robots will begin their delivery journey.

The robots will only be delivering to customers that live within a mile of Warth Park. Customers that are due to receive a robot delivery will first have to confirm that they are at home to accept the parcel.

They will then be able to track the robot's progress from the DPD depot to their home. When the robot arrives at its destination, the customer will use a specific code to open one of the three secure compartments on the robot to access their parcel.

Once the customer closes the compartment, the robot will either travel back to the Warth Park depot, or to the next home delivery. The robots run on a 12-hour battery life, so will be travelling around Raunds throughout the day.

North Northamptonshire Council has worked closely with DPD to introduce delivery robots in the county, and is pleased that this scheme has been launched. Cllr Graham Lawman, the Executive Member for Highways, Travel and Assets for North Northamptonshire Council said of the scheme: "We are delighted that DPD is introducing delivery robots in Raunds.

"The council is committed to the environment and supporting clean and green alternatives to traditional forms of transport to reduce emissions. It is great to be able to help bring this innovation to North Northamptonshire."

Tim Jones, the Director of Marketing, Communications and Sustainability for the DPDGroup UK added: "The trial in Milton Keynes has been a huge success for us. The robots have exceeded our expectations, and the feedback has been fantastic.

"We can see people's reactions when they meet them, and it is overwhelmingly positive." The DPD robots were first introduced in Milton Keynes in July 2022, and their success has meant they are now expanding across the country in an effort to increase sustainability.

Some Raunds residents have already spotted the robots in the street, and there will definitely be more of them to come.
